The PEUGEOT 306 (1997-02) is a popular hatchback model that offered a practical and reliable choice for drivers in the UK during its production years. Known for its compact size, it’s well-suited for city driving, commuting, and small families. Its ease of handling and affordable running costs have made it a common option among first-time drivers and budget-conscious buyers. Based on over a thousand checks on mycarcheck.com, the PEUGEOT 306 (1997-02) is often seen with around 101,000 miles and typically has been owned by about four to five previous owners. Its popularity reflects its reputation for simplicity and reliability, with the average private sale value around £100, making it an affordable used car choice. The model is recognized for its comfortable ride, practical design, and fuel efficiency, which still appeal to those seeking an economical vehicle. Compared to rivals of its era, the PEUGEOT 306 stands out with its distinctive styling and solid build quality. Its reputation for durability and low maintenance costs means it remains a memorable option for budget-conscious drivers and small families looking for a dependable, easy-to-drive car. The PEUGEOT 306 (1997-02) continues to be a notable name in the used car market for its value and practicality.
